This morning's section of the bible talks about the Lord being offended and frustrated by the Israelis' lack of trust in Him, and even going so far as to favor Moses, Joshua and Caleb over the rest. Didn't the bible teach us not to be offended, (Ref Proverbs 19:11
) and show partiality (Ref Romans 2:11)?
We may be offended and frustrated when people refuse to accept, follow Christ diligently. This is a legitimate response according to today's Scriptures. If we are OK with these attitudes and behaviors, we may need to question ourselves the level of our faith and walk with the Lord, that includes allowing lukewarmness in the church. (Ref Revelation 3:15-16)
How about our own agendas? If the agendas we are frustrated and offended about have their roots in the Lord, then it is legitimate for us to be angry about them. This may include our appearance, marriage, family, finances, callings etc., the areas where the Lord has had His touch on and is leading us. (Ref Genesis 1:27) We can even favor those who are for us and support us so that His plans can be accomplished through us.
Today, let us ask the guidance of the Holy Spirit to give us wisdom on what Scriptures to apply in different situations. This is because offense and partiality at times is a valuable response to further advancing the Kingdom of God. We don't need to condemn ourselves simply because we have those emotions. (Ref Romans 8:1)
